Q: Is 2,886,025 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,886,025 is a composite number.

Why is 2,886,025 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,886,025 can be evenly divided by 1 5 25 67 335 1,675 1,723 8,615 43,075 115,441 577,205 and 2,886,025, with no remainder.

Since 2,886,025 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,886,025, it is a composite number.
